The monotypic genus Allopsalliota (Agaricaceae, Agaricales, Basidiomycota) was created to accommodate Allopsalliota geesterani, originally described as Agaricus geesterani. After reexamination of this species based on both morphological characters and molecular phylogenetic evidence, we conclude that Allopsalliota should be considered a synonym of Micropsalliota, and we propose the transfer of Al. geesterani into Micropsalliota.
